Actor
The Resume
(May 31, 1930- )
Birth name is Clinton Eastwood, Jr.
Mayor of Carmel-by-the-Sea, CA (1986)
Won the 1992 Oscar for best director (Unforgiven)
Starred in 'The Good, Bad and Ugly,' 'Dirty Harry,' 'Paint Your Wagon,' 'Play Misty for Me,' 'Tightrope,' 'Unforgiven,' 'Bridges of Madison County,' 'Pink Cadillac,' 'City Heat,' 'Escape from Alcatraz,' 'Firefox,' 'Magnum Force' and 'Every Which Way but Loose'
Why he might be annoying
He takes forever to speak his lines.
The Washington Post says Clint Eastwood, the director, puts the audience to sleep.
As a surprise guest speaker at the Republican National Convention, he made a rambling, uncscripted speech, which included him talking to an empty stool (August 30, 2012).
Why he might not be annoying
He sued the National Enquirer and won $150,000 proving that he did not participate in their claimed exclusive interview (1993).
He ranked #2, in Empire Magazine's Top 100 Movie Stars of All Time.
He ranked #69 in Empire Magazine's 100 Sexiest Movie Stars of All Time..
His trademark lines are 'Do you feel lucky, punk' and 'Make my Day.'
When Jane Alexander's four year old son said 'Make My Day' to him, he replied 'Make Your Bed!'
He donates all his profits from his own beer brand 'Pale Ride Ale' to charity.
He was wounded in the military.
